Why do my lights flicker during storms with Withlacoochee River Electric Cooperative?

Flickering during storms is often tied to our high lightning surge risk. The utility grid experiences momentary faults or surges that affect your home's voltage. Beyond being a nuisance, these surges can degrade or destroy sensitive modern electronics like computers and smart home hubs. Installing a whole-house surge protector at your main service panel is a critical defense to absorb these spikes before they reach your appliances.

Does the flat, sandy soil around Zephyr Park affect my home's electrical grounding?

Yes, terrain directly impacts grounding effectiveness. Sandy soil has high electrical resistance, which can compromise the path for fault current from your grounding electrode system. This makes proper installation and periodic testing of ground rods crucial. We often recommend supplemental grounding measures or chemical treatments to the soil around the rods to achieve the low resistance required by the NEC for safety.

How should I prepare my home's electrical system for a summer brownout or a rare winter freeze?

For summer AC peaks that strain the grid, ensure your HVAC system has a dedicated, properly sized circuit and clean components to reduce strain. Consider a hardwired standby generator with an automatic transfer switch for essential circuits during prolonged outages. For winter, while prolonged freezes are rare, protecting outdoor receptacles and ensuring heat tape circuits are GFCI-protected is prudent. Surge protection remains a year-round priority given our storm activity.

What are the pros and cons of having overhead electrical service lines to my house?

Overhead mast service, common here, provides accessible points for utility connection and meter reading. The primary downside is exposure to weather and falling debris, which can cause outages. It also requires proper masthead clearance and secure mast conduits to withstand high winds. For any service upgrade or mast repair, the utility has specific requirements we coordinate with to ensure a safe, compliant installation from the weatherhead to your main panel.

Can my 1986 home with a 150-amp panel safely add a Level 2 EV charger or a new heat pump?

It depends heavily on your panel's condition and brand. A 150-amp service may support these additions with a proper load calculation and dedicated circuit installation. However, if your home still has a recalled Federal Pacific panel, that upgrade is not just recommended—it's mandatory for safety before adding any major load. These panels are known for failing to trip during overloads, creating a significant fire hazard with high-draw equipment like EV chargers.
